Multiple solutions for asymptotically q-linear (p,q)-Laplacian problems

Abstract

We investigate the existence and the multiplicity of solutions of the problem cases -p u-q u = g(x, u) & in ,\\ u=0 & on ∂, cases where is a smooth, bounded domain of RN, 1<p<q<∞, and the nonlinearity g behaves as uq-1 at infinity. We use variational methods and find multiple solutions as minimax critical points of the associated energy functional. Under suitable assumptions on the nonlinearity, we cover also the resonant case.
